Gas jet interaction with a stationary and rotating barrier of high-permeability porous material

V. K. Baev, A. N. Bazhaikin

Khristianovich Institute of Theoretical and Applied Mechanics, Siberian Branch of the Russian Academy of Sciences, Novosibirsk

Abstract: An experimental study was conducted on the interaction of a carbon dioxide axisymmetric jet with a stationary and rotating gas-permeable barrier. Flow patterns and spatial distributions of CO$_2$ concentrations are described depending on experimental conditions. The possibility of using obtained results for setting up various physico-chemical processes is considered.
